From the plateau to the mountain peak, De Gasperi's birthplace
Pieve del Tesino is a winter and summer tourist destination and is renowned as it houses the birthplace of statesman Alcide De Gasperi (1881-1954). The village is located on the Southern foot of Monte Silana and opens up fan-shaped within the Tesino Basin.
Tourists to the area can enjoy walks and hikes surrounded by its beautiful landscape. The granite massif of Cima D´Asta (2,847 m) stands to the North of the village, and is one of the most popular destinations for alpinists and amateur mountaineers on the Alta via del Granito.
The Museo Casa De Gasperi (De Gasperi's Museum-Home), the churches of the Assunta and of San Sebastiano and the beautiful Villa Daziaro (private property) are all worth a visit, as are the Arboreto del Tesino, the River Park, Val Malene and the Cima d'Asta Range.
Visitors can also enjoy a round of Golf at La Farfalla golf course.

Car:
Pieve Tesino can be reached along the Brennero A 22 motorway (exit at Trento Centro, 52 km), continuing along SS 47 della Valsugana and turning onto SP 78 del Tesino.
Public transport:
FS station Trento (Munich-Rome line)
FS station Strigno (Valsugana line, Trento-Venice)
Società Atesina bus connection: from Trento and Strigno
Airplane:
The nearest airports are Verona Catullo at about 90 km, Venice Marco Polo at 195 km, Milan Linate at 245 km and the new airport of Bolzano at 60 km.
